To the release manager: I'm passing ownership of the Pellwick deep-link router to Sorrel before the 4.2 cut. The intent-matching table now lives in the Farrowgate config service; stale entries were purged last sprint. Watch the fallback route — it silently swallows malformed slugs, which inflated our drop-off metrics in March. The staging resolver needs its keystore unlocked before each regression pass, and that keystore accepts only one credential. For the signing vault, the recovery phrase is noted directly below.

recovery phrase for tafog-fafog: novix-novdor-fraath-brieth-olieth-oliix-rusix-wenion-julax-druox

Handover: Encoding Detection (Quillbarrow Uploads)

The detection module now handles UTF-16 and legacy codepages; fallbacks log a warning instead of failing silently. Release manager should gate the rollout behind the upload flag. If the detection cache locks during deploy, unlock it manually before retrying. The cache unlock passphrase is below.

unlock words, yawig-kagef: gordor-holvan-ulaael-pramir-ulaiel-tamdor

## Runbook: Fleet fuel-usage report (Haulmark)

Report generates nightly at 02:10. If it's missing by 03:00, check the aggregator pod first — it's usually a stale odometer feed from the Brindlegate depot sync. Restart the sync job, then re-trigger the report manually with `haulmark report --rerun`. The rerun requires the aggregator credential to be present in the job's environment file, or it fails silently with exit 0. Confirm the env file contains this line.

vault entry, yahif-yajep: COURIER_KEY29=b802bdf8034096b65a51c6ba5abe2

# CI Note: Farebeam Pricing Experiment

The tiered-pricing experiment for Farebeam keeps failing the snapshot stage. Cause: the experiment flag seeds prices from a fixture that assumes whole-dollar tiers; the new 15% off-peak tier produces cents. Fix: regenerate fixtures after toggling the flag, then rerun. Do not pin the old fixture hash. The passing run's trace token is recorded directly below.

build token for fajof-yahof: htk4_869f